Basics (2000)
1. Name Essex County ('FIPS' code: 25009)
2. State Massachusetts
3. Population 723,419
4. Avg. household income 68,548
5. Median household income 51,576
Population Segments: By Age, Race and Ethnicity (2000)
6. Number of children under 5 47,797
7. Number of children ages 5-17 133,841
8. Number of adults, 18-64 441,558
9. Number of elderly 100,223
10. Number of black non-Hispanics 13,714
11. Number of Hispanics 79,629
12. Number of Asians 17,211
13. Number of Native Americans (non-Hispanic) 1,019
Community Needs: Unemployment, Poverty, Education & Disability (2000)
14. Unemployment rate 4.60
15. Number in poverty 63,137
16. % in poverty 8.73
17. Number of children in poverty 21,823
18. % of children in poverty 12.01
19. Number of elderly in poverty 8,343
20. % without high school diploma (over 25 years old) 15.39
21. % with disability, ages 5-15 5.93
22. % with disability, ages 16-64 18.24
23. % with disability, ages 65 & over 37.47
